The video discusses the challenges and political issues surrounding immigration reform in the U.S., focusing on the H1B visa program and its impact on the job market. It highlights the benefits of skilled immigrants in Silicon Valley and the problems faced by those waiting for green cards. The discussion also addresses misconceptions about outsourcing and the role of immigrants in driving competition and innovation in America.
